Disney Feast West & East : Day 25 : checking out of OKW and checking in to WestHaven

Very sad to be leaving our lovely Disney bubble today – its been fabulous in every way.

The plan is to check out , leave cases in the car and ask bell services if we can stow our groceries while we have breakfast and chill out by the pool until our villa is ready around 3pm. But Andy calls the management company and explains about the groceries so they are fine with us taking the cases and food stuffs and stowing them at the villa while the cleaning is progress – as long as we don’t come back to actually unpack till later in the day.

This is around 9am so Andy decides we need to go NOW which has us in a spin as we are not all up. As Connor is up and dressed he is duly volunteered to load the car and act as navigator while I and the other two will finish packing and take all out last bits and bobs down to the pool area and meet the others at Olivias for breakfast.

Connor is less than thrilled – even more so as the satnav wont recognise the WestHaven address and its not on the mapman map – but I do show him Champions Gate as its near there so they should be able to find their way from there.

As they set off, I am glad its not a journey I am making ! Its just gone 10 and I suspect they will not be back for breakfast at all.

We leave the villa and take our bits and bobs down to the pool and I take some final resort pics.

We head off to Olivias for an early lunch and its lovely in here.





lovely bread as always



The boys have ribs ( connor’s were nice, jamies were chewy),



Andy has strip steak



and Nick and I have a cheeseburger.



We order some desserts to go and the boys go off to make use of the pool while Andy and I stay to share a Cheesecake ( delicious) and key lime pie ( too much crust).





The meal has a $value of £158 , which feels quite a lot. We leave a $28 tip and feel quite pleased that we managed all our TS meals in the end.

We spend a while at the pool, it really does feel like “home”. We set off for DTD to make the most of our snack credits at Goofys Candy store. We have decided to split them 5 ways so that’s 6 each and the spare one for Andy. The boys buy candy , cookies and muffins and we stock up on bottled drinks as they will be handy in the next few days. We have a fridge full of desserts already waiting for us so don’t need anymore sweet things !

I find the gamesroom ( it’s the garage) and the boys are very pleased – although its well hot in there so a morning and evening room only !









The villa has been very well prepared, a few signs of wear and tear but has a lovely feel. Nice pool, nice aspect and very comfy. I begin the last unpack ( I hate these cases) , bearing in mind that the day after tomorrow we have two nights at Universal so I will need to pack for that at some point …


It is nice to mooch about in our own space. Around 5pm Andy announces he is going back to DTD to use up our last CS credits at Wolfgang Puck. He takes connor with him who makes some jest about not being back till gone 7 , which we laugh off but turns out to be quite prophetic.


While they are gone, there is a heavy downpour which finishes just as they arrive back.






Apparently they had got caught in that rain on the way there and back which slowed them down and WPE was packed . They have a big haul with them of 7 BBQ chicken pizzas ( 4 for tonight and 3 for the freezer) , Andy’s usual rotisserie chicken, a small mountain of cookies and bottles of orange juice. Great use of our last 8 credits and a $value of $159.

We have dinner out on the patio and have a swim, with the boys generally messing about and enjoying the freedom . Andy and I sit outside reading with a glass of wine – this feels so relaxing.

We have an early start tomorrow for Seaworld so off to bed around 9pm but then there is a huge lightning storm so we all get up to watch it across the sky. The storm carries on for some time , probably related to all the disturbance related to Hurricane Isaac which is starting to occupy a lot of airtime now and is making us consider our plans for when we visit Busch Gardens, but a few days yet to make any decisions.
